Transaction ad63a87a168d53053e660e8fac8b7bbbb21386cf7dccb860ff44038396c9d063
1 Input
2 Outputs
- ad63a87a168d53053e660e8fac8b7bbbb21386cf7dccb860ff44038396c9d063:0
- ad63a87a168d53053e660e8fac8b7bbbb21386cf7dccb860ff44038396c9d063:1
value 7399964
address 1P67eGU1wpBikmGVzyd5rk4ALBS5euCcxh
value 14000000
address 32B617SgFKp7q3kLe1XrxbUsAHU6DQEyzu